Do sunflower seeds have mold?

Do sunflower seeds have mold? Michigan State University researchers have shown that sunflower seeds are frequently contaminated with a toxin produced by molds and pose an increased health risk in many low-income countries worldwide. … This is one of the first studies to associate aflatoxin contamination with sunflower seeds.

Do sunflower seeds have fungus? A team of scientists documented the frequent instances of a toxin called aflatoxin, produced by Aspergillus molds, found in sunflower seeds and their products. Aspergillus molds commonly infect corn, peanuts, pistachios and almonds. … The remaining sunflower seed cakes are used as animal feed.

How do you know if sunflower seeds are bad? You won’t be sick after eating rancid sunflower seeds, but the smell (and usually taste) will be quite bad. Discard if the seeds smell off. Off taste. … If the seeds taste sour, get rid of them.

Do sunflowers mold? Flowerheads eventually rot. High humidity, temperatures between 50 and 60 degrees Fahrenheit and high-nitrogen, foliage-promoting fertilizers encourage white mold. Space sunflowers to discourage plant-to-plant contamination and water them in early morning for quick drying.

Where can you find a mold fossil?

We find molds where an animal or plant was buried in mud or soft soil and decayed away, leaving behind an impression of their bodies, leaves, or flowers. Casts are formed when these impressions are filled with other types of sediment that form rocks, which take the place of the animal or plant.

How can you tell if mold is in the house?

If your home has water stains, discoloration on walls, floor, or ceilings, of if you notice bubbling, cracking, or peeling paint or wallpaper, then you’re likely dealing with mold-producing problems. Water leaks. … Areas where condensation often form can also be a haven for mold, such as windows and metal pipes.

What is a contract of adhesion in law?

Overview. An adhesion contract (also called a “standard form contract” or a “boilerplate contract”) is a contract drafted by one party (usually a business with stronger bargaining power) and signed by another party (usually one with weaker bargaining power, usually a consumer in need of goods or services).
